Rare turnkey triplex in the heart of Ottawa's rapidly appreciating Vanier/Beechwood Village corridor. This meticulously maintained income property offers three fully tenanted units sharing a consistent layout across all floors, zero vacancy history, and exceptional long-term upside in one of the city's most sought-after emerging neighbourhoods, steps from vibrant Beechwood Avenue, Rockcliffe Park, and the Ottawa River pathways. With over $293,000 in confirmed capital investment since 2010, this is a property where the heavy lifting has already been done. Major improvements include a brand new high-efficiency boiler (2025), 90% of main cast iron pipes replaced with PVC (2026), full foundation waterproofing with sump pump and French drain system, roof in excellent condition (inspected and reflashed 2023), complete building refacing with Permacon and CanExcel cladding, new concrete front stairs, a fully redone interlock backyard and parking area, and a shed with individual storage lockers, dedicated electrical panel and new roofing. A lifetime pest control contract and updated appliances in all three units round out a truly turnkey asset. All units are occupied by excellent long-term tenants with zero tribunal history. Current gross annual income of $57,140 with significant upside as all three units are below market rent, with stabilized market rents projecting to $72,300 annually. The property is zoned N4B[1322] H(11), permitting low-rise multi-unit development up to three storeys, offering compelling future redevelopment optionality in a neighbourhood where land values are rising.
